Gravel Maintenance in Calvert County, MD

Gravel maintenance services involve the ongoing care and upkeep of gravel surfaces on residential properties, such as driveways, pathways, and landscaping features. These services typically include grading to level the surface, replenishing gravel to fill in low spots, and compacting to ensure stability and proper drainage. Homeowners often request gravel maintenance to improve the appearance of their property, prevent erosion, and extend the lifespan of gravel areas by keeping them functional and safe.

Before requesting gravel maintenance, property owners should consider the current condition of their gravel surfaces, including any areas showing signs of displacement, ruts, or erosion. Understanding the scope of work needed-whether it’s simply adding gravel or also involves reshaping and compacting-can help in planning the project. Clarifying the type of gravel used and any specific drainage concerns can also ensure the maintenance services meet the property's needs effectively.

Common Gravel Maintenance Jobs

Gravel driveway maintenance - regular raking and leveling help prevent erosion and keep surfaces smooth.

Gravel pathway upkeep - topping with fresh gravel restores appearance and fills in low spots.

Gravel parking areas - periodic grading improves drainage and prevents loose gravel from scattering.

Drainage correction - shaping gravel beds ensures proper water flow and reduces pooling.

Weed control for gravel surfaces - applying weed barrier fabric and removal prevents unwanted growth.

Gravel surface repairs - filling in holes and regrading maintains safety and functionality.

Gravel Maintenance Questions

What is gravel maintenance? Gravel maintenance involves raking, leveling, and replenishing gravel to keep driveways, pathways, and landscaping looking neat and functional.

Why is gravel maintenance important? Regular maintenance prevents erosion, reduces weed growth, and maintains the appearance and durability of gravel surfaces.

What projects typically require gravel maintenance? Common projects include driveway upkeep, garden pathways, and decorative gravel areas that need regular leveling and replenishment.

How often should gravel be maintained? Gravel surfaces generally benefit from periodic inspections and maintenance, especially after severe weather or heavy use.
